TP钱包安卓版深度解析:密码管理到分布式账本的全链路技术展望

本文围绕“TP钱包安卓版App”展开,系统探讨其在密码管理、高效能技术转型、专业剖析、智能化金融支付、实时交易确认与分布式账本技术等方面的关键能力与未来方向。以用户可感知的安全体验与工程可验证的技术路径为主线,给出一个从架构到实现思路的全景视图。

一、密码管理:从“可用”到“可托付”的安全链路

在移动端钱包中,密码管理决定了“资产是否能长期安全使用”。TP钱包安卓版通常需要处理以下几类核心要素:

1)密钥体系与用户心智

- 钱包通常采用助记词(Seed)或私钥体系:助记词用于离线恢复,私钥用于链上签名。

- 用户侧需要“易用且不易错”的恢复流程:包括备份提示、校验机制(如助记词拼写/顺序校验)与容错设计。

2)口令与加密存储

- 口令(或本地设置的密码)更多用于加密本地敏感数据,例如种子/私钥的加密落盘。

- 安全目标不仅是“加密”,还包括:防止明文落地、降低内存驻留风险、避免日志泄露、避免备份误传。

3)安全模块与本地环境对抗

- 若设备支持硬件安全能力(如安全硬件/TEE/Keystore),可将关键材料尽可能放到受控执行环境。

- 对抗面包括:恶意App读取、调试注入、系统Root带来的威胁、截屏/剪贴板泄露等。

4)重置与迁移策略

- 用户更换手机或系统迁移时,需要“可恢复”但仍保持安全:通过助记词/密钥导入重建本地加密层。

- 应避免“只改密码不动密钥导致的安全假象”:严格验证密钥解密路径与加密重建流程。

5)面向未来的密码学改进

- 使用更稳健的密钥派生与参数化策略(例如KDF的迭代参数随版本更新)。

- 引入更细粒度的访问控制:例如分区权限、签名确认弹窗、交易复核摘要可视化。

总结来看,密码管理的核心不是某个算法名,而是“密钥生命周期管理”:生成—存储—解锁—签名—销毁—恢复,形成端到端可审计、可验证与可持续升级的闭环。

二、高效能技术转型:让安全与性能同时在线

移动端钱包面临“安全计算 + 网络交互 + 频繁UI反馈”的多重压力。高效能技术转型通常体现为工程架构与链路优化:

1)签名与交易构建提速

- 对交易构建流程做模块化拆分:字段校验、序列化、签名参数准备并行化。

- 针对常见操作(转账、合约调用、代币交换)建立模板化交易流水线,减少重复计算。

2)网络层性能与失败恢复

- 使用更智能的请求队列与重试策略:区块链网络存在拥堵与节点波动,需区分可重试与不可重试错误。

- 对“广播—确认—回执解析”设置异步状态机,避免阻塞UI线程。

3)本地缓存与索引加速

- 对代币列表、价格展示、历史交易等数据使用分层缓存:内存缓存、持久化缓存、并设置过期策略。

- 对链上数据进行轻量索引(依赖节点/服务提供的查询能力),减少全量拉取。

4)客户端体积与渲染效率

- 减少不必要的依赖与重复计算,优化列表渲染(例如分页、虚拟化、增量更新)。

- 对交易详情渲染进行延迟加载:先给关键字段,后补充可展开的复杂信息。

5)安全校验与性能的平衡

- 安全校验(例如地址格式、合约参数、签名摘要)必须存在,但不应拖慢主流程。

- 方案通常是“前置轻校验 + 关键步骤深校验”:用户体验更稳,风险控制更精确。

三、专业剖析展望:架构视角的能力拆解

从专业架构角度,一个成熟钱包可拆成几条关键链路:

1)账户/密钥层

- 负责密钥派生、加解密、签名输出、密钥销毁与可恢复机制。

2)交易编排层

- 负责交易构建、参数组装、Gas/费用估算(若适用)、nonce/序列号管理(取决于链)。

3)链上交互层

- 负责节点选择、RPC调用、交易广播、回执查询、事件解析。

4)状态与风控层

- 负责交易状态机(Pending/Confirmed/Failed)、风险标注(可疑合约、异常路由、签名与UI不一致检测)。

5)数据与展示层

- 负责资产总览、代币明细、历史交易、通知提醒与可视化摘要。

未来展望的关键是:将这些层解耦并引入可观测性(日志与指标但需注意隐私),使得性能、稳定性、安全性可量化改进。

四、智能化金融支付:从“转账工具”到“支付协同体”

智能化金融支付并不意味着“只靠AI”,而是把支付从单一转账动作升级为多步骤协同:

1)支付流程自动化

- 自动生成交易所需参数:选择合适资产、估算费用、提示最优路径。

- 引入“策略层”:例如在多路路由、不同手续费情况下做推荐或最小滑点策略(取决于链与生态)。

2)风险感知与合规提示

- 交易前展示风险摘要:接收方、代币合约、权限调用范围(例如授权类操作)。

- 对钓鱼地址、假冒代币、异常approve额度进行拦截或强制确认。

3)支付智能化的“交互设计”

- 把复杂链上字段转为用户可理解的语言:金额、手续费、净到账、潜在授权。

- 在确认弹窗中引入“签名摘要可视化”,避免用户在高风险场景盲签。

4)面向场景的能力扩展

- 支付场景包括线上付款、线下收款码、跨链资产结算(取决于生态集成)、分账与订阅。

五、实时交易确认:从“等结果”到“可预测的确认”

实时交易确认是用户体验的核心指标。钱包需要在“速度、准确性、资源消耗”之间取平衡:

1)确认策略

- 广播后进入Pending状态,并通过轮询或订阅(取决于链与节点能力)获取回执。

- 为用户提供“预计确认时间”的动态提示(基于历史统计或当前网络拥堵信号)。

2)多阶段回执

- 在部分链上可能存在“被打包/最终确认”的不同阶段。

- 钱包应区分阶段并更新UI,避免仅用单一“是否成功”误导用户。

3)处理链上重组或延迟

- 极端情况下可能出现回执延迟或状态回滚,钱包需具备容错:例如短时间内状态抖动时保持谨慎提示。

4)失败诊断与可行动建议

- 失败不只是标记Failed,还应给出原因线索:如手续费不足、nonce冲突、合约执行异常。

- 提供可行动建议:是否可重试、建议的重试参数或重新构建交易。

六、分布式账本技术:让“信任”更可计算

分布式账本技术(DLT)是加密资产系统的底层。钱包侧要与其正确协作:

1)一致性与可验证性

- 区块链通过共识机制实现账本一致性。

- 钱包通过交易签名与验证流程,让网络节点能够对交易合法性进行验证并写入账本。

2)不可篡改与审计

- 区块链的不可篡改使历史交易具有可审计性。

- 钱包展示层应正确解析交易数据与事件日志,确保用户看到的账本事实与链上状态一致。

3)分布式带来的工程挑战

- 节点差异、网络延迟、RPC限流会导致钱包在查询与确认上出现不稳定。

- 钱包需做节点管理与降级:优先可靠节点,备用节点,必要时引入聚合查询。

4)隐私与最小披露

- 分布式账本天然公开,钱包可通过最小披露原则减少不必要的链上交互频率。

- 交易前摘要与展示应避免引导用户泄露敏感信息(例如地址/备注的隐私风险)。

结语:安全为底座,性能为杠杆,智能化为体验,实时确认为信任,DLT为根系

综上,TP钱包安卓版的发展可从“密码管理的可信生命周期”入手,叠加“高效能技术转型”的工程能力,再通过“智能化金融支付”提升场景体验;同时以“实时交易确认”保障用户决策信心,并以“分布式账本技术”保持链上可验证的底层一致性。未来的关键趋势是:安全与性能共进化、交互与风控深度融合、确认体验可量化与可预测。

作者:林澈发布时间:2026-05-14 18:01:46

评论

NovaLi

读完对TP钱包的链路划分更清楚了,尤其是“交易状态机+实时回执”的思路很实用。

小川同学

关于密码管理那段写得很到位:不仅要加密存储,还要把生命周期闭环做成可审计。

AidenK

智能化支付我理解成“策略+风险感知+可视化确认”,比单纯的自动化更符合真实产品。

MiraZhang

实时交易确认的多阶段回执讲得很专业,能减少用户对Failed/Confirmed的误解。

Zed

分布式账本技术那部分让我想到钱包侧要做节点管理与降级,工程稳定性才是关键。

雨后风铃

希望后续能看到更具体的工程实现细节,比如轮询频率、重试策略和隐私最小披露怎么落地。

相关阅读
<bdo date-time="p2q2ic"></bdo><center dir="a6xmyk"></center><time dir="396lfv"></time><dfn dir="k5mxrq"></dfn>